This year I will be fishing with self tied flies .
Last year I had the best luck with an ultralight rig, 4# line, with small dark flies fished behind a plastic casting bubble. Most of my fishing was the hour before daylight which might of had some effect on the fly color.
I fished a small city park duck pond in Longview that was just minutes from where I worked.
Never had anyone else fishing at that hour.
Had multiple hits almost every cast on a steady slow retrieve.
I think the released trout have all been fed pellet food at certain times of the day but get hungry enough once release to hit almost anything that resembles food to them.

Travis, I'm up here in the Dallas area, but I picked it up real fast. Get yourself some tiny hooks.. no bigger than #6. Then get yourself some orange TROUT power bait. Make sure it says trout and not crappie. Super light rig.. just enough weight to keep the hook down, on a maximum 6# line... I really prefer 4#.

Feel for the thumps. They bite about like crappie for me, just barely a little bump sometimes, and then pull. They'll give a wonderful fight for their size.. and the big ones are loads of fun!
